For 129 years Stradey Park was the home of Llanelli rugby. It was a stage for sporting legends, a cauldron of emotion. By 2008, however, it was time for the Scarlets and Llanelli RFC to move on. In a new era of high-tech stadia, this welcoming venue of great social gatherings had become a well-worn museum piece. This is your chance to relive forever the spirit of Stradey in its final days. Powerful images and warm recollections celebrate its unique qualities and honour everyone from the burger sellers to the British Lions. Photographer Terry Morris and writer Andy Pearson were granted unparalleled access to the ground throughout the 2007-08 campaign.
